A building 20 meters high stands on the top of a hill. Form a point at the foot of the hill,
the angles of elevation to the top and bottom of the building are 41° 27′ and 37°22′,
respectively. Find the height of the hill?

Hint:
This is what the diagram could look like

The diagram was made with GeoGebra.

Points:Further useful information:Yet another hint: Break the figure into two separate right triangles ADC and BDC.
Use trigonometry to determine x and y.
